Corey Feldman Describes “Dancing With the Stars” Behind-the-Scenes Toxicity

Ella Thomas, November 24, 2025

Corey Feldman revealed the behind-the-scenes environment of “Dancing With the Stars” is marked by what he calls “unusually toxic” conversations. In an upcoming episode of the “Gurvey’s Law” radio show, released by the Daily Mail, Feldman detailed his concerns about the off-camera atmosphere, stating that work inside the studio was straightforward but the conversation outside it suggested otherwise. “There was a lot of stupidity in the mudslinging that went on behind the scenes,” he said. “Actually, there, everything was great, but the behind-the-scenes drama and BS that people throw around that show, I’ve never seen anything like it. It’s the worst, like, most toxic.”

Feldman appeared in Season 34 with professional dancer Jenna Johnson, whose partnership lasted two weeks, ending after a cha-cha to Sir Mix-a-Lot’s “Baby Got Back.” He described rehearsals as conflict-free and cast members maintaining a focused routine throughout taping. “On the set, everybody gets along. Everybody’s great; everybody’s happy. You’re working hard. You don’t even have time to look up; you’re just working,” he said in the interview. However, Feldman noted that problems emerged when he saw stories describing alleged disagreements among participants or claims that his involvement had negatively affected the show. “This person’s mad at this person. These people aren’t talking to each other,” he said, citing reports accusing him of causing trouble, including claims that “Corey Feldman destroyed the show.”

Some of that commentary reflected earlier remarks from former “Dancing With the Stars” professional Maksim Chmerkovskiy, who told the Daily Mail in September that Johnson was struggling with the season’s pairing. “Obviously, Jenna has a bit of an uphill climb with Corey, which is easy for everybody to say from [outside],” Chmerkovskiy said. “But I know that she’s having a much more difficult time with this entire thing and to the point that it is really difficult for her.” According to Feldman, he later asked Johnson about the comments. He said she dismissed them and responded, “‘Oh, it’s just Maks. Don’t pay attention to him; he just wants attention.'”

Feldman released a statement to clarify his position, emphasizing that his remarks were not directed at the show’s staff or cast. “I want to make it absolutely clear that my experience on Dancing with the Stars has been positive,” he said in the statement. “Everyone associated with the show — from my fellow cast members to the pros, crew and production team — has treated me with nothing but kindness, support, and respect.” He noted that concerns involved only commentary from those outside the production. “The issues I was referring to have nothing to do with the show itself. They relate to the outside commentary, rumors and individuals who are no longer directly involved with ‘DWTS’ but still feel entitled to weigh in and create unnecessary drama.”

Feldman said he is looking forward to returning to rehearsals and dancing with Jenna again. “The ‘DWTS’ family has been wonderful, and I’m grateful for the opportunity to be part of it.” He returned to the set in recent days, sharing photos from the visit, including a reunion with Johnson and shots with professional dancer Britt Stewart and former NBA player Baron Davis, the first pair eliminated this season.
